Commit Graph

  • 8d7897d04d manifest schema: allow caps for install.*.choices keys Félix Piédallu 2024-02-20 13:41:31 +01:00
  • cd1e7cb7fa Merge pull request #2034 from OniriCorpe/patch-1 eric_G 2024-02-20 13:10:30 +01:00
  • d56bc1eb4c Update apps.toml OniriCorpe 2024-02-20 05:34:36 +01:00
  • 5aa7a0f5df Merge pull request #2039 from Salamandar/fix_double_slash Tagada 2024-02-19 17:16:57 +01:00
  • 4a06a1ee8f autoupdater: Fix double slash in gitlab and gitea forges Félix Piédallu 2024-02-19 16:38:51 +01:00
  • 94ab3d33ce Merge branch 'patch-2' of git@github.com:OniriCorpe/apps.git OniriCorpe 2024-02-19 05:00:19 +01:00
  • d4adcd9ba3 smol translation fix OniriCorpe 2024-02-19 05:00:11 +01:00
  • 0e34a00c1f Update README.md OniriCorpe 2024-02-19 04:51:49 +01:00
  • 20a6120571 updating translations & smol fixes OniriCorpe 2024-02-19 02:31:41 +01:00
  • 4553d2fc2d Update app.py OniriCorpe 2024-02-19 02:19:21 +01:00
  • 59fecb7d1d Update app.py OniriCorpe 2024-02-19 01:34:28 +01:00
  • 018e9624c7 Update app.py OniriCorpe 2024-02-19 01:23:30 +01:00
  • 80fff8984d Add ‘pip3 install tqdm GitPython’ required for list_builder.py OniriCorpe 2024-02-19 01:10:27 +01:00
  • 641d50bf63 Allow html in errormsg OniriCorpe 2024-02-18 22:42:43 +01:00
  • cb6845bb35 Many texts improvements, to enhance user understanding OniriCorpe 2024-02-18 22:40:21 +01:00
  • 972486ab2f Add Bitmagne to wishlist yunohost-bot 2024-02-18 19:16:37 +01:00
  • 076c14fad9 Update apps.toml OniriCorpe 2024-02-18 02:03:10 +01:00
  • b54712ac46 Merge pull request #2033 from Salamandar/fix_version_number Tagada 2024-02-17 19:10:31 +01:00
  • 7776f15cc9 Fix version numbering in source autoupdating (remove leading v) Félix Piédallu 2024-02-17 19:06:20 +01:00
  • 0b3f41b916 Merge pull request #2032 from Salamandar/fix_autoupdater Alexandre Aubin 2024-02-17 16:04:07 +01:00
  • 288a7870df autoupdate.version_regex: allow multiple capture groups, splitted by '.' Félix Piédallu 2024-02-17 15:41:57 +01:00
  • 95a2419975 Merge pull request #2031 from OniriCorpe/patch-1 Alexandre Aubin 2024-02-17 14:24:09 +01:00
  • 5a21332ca3 Create penpot.png Éric Gaspar 2024-02-17 10:29:14 +01:00
  • 56e2137c69 Icecoder is deprecated OniriCorpe 2024-02-17 06:06:16 +01:00
  • 01020522de Merge pull request #2030 from Salamandar/fix_autoupdater Alexandre Aubin 2024-02-17 00:39:43 +01:00
  • 265a94745e Apps can now provide a "version_regex" that aims to extract the version from tag an release names. Félix Piédallu 2024-02-16 23:59:54 +01:00
  • 4107216ab3 Gitlab replaces / with - in tag tarballs Félix Piédallu 2024-02-16 23:53:55 +01:00
  • 33edc74ac5 autoupdater: Call infos.get("autoupdate") way sooner for cleaner code Félix Piédallu 2024-02-16 22:10:00 +01:00
  • 03facd3df8 Fix autoupdater for forges allowing for non-domain-root install and multiple levels of projects Félix Piédallu 2024-02-16 19:36:52 +01:00
  • 615622ffff Add ITTools to wishlist yunohost-bot 2024-02-16 21:17:48 +01:00
  • dab2524f9c rest_api: rename properties for readability Félix Piédallu 2024-02-16 19:07:20 +01:00
  • 15b2207054 Clean message issues Félix Piédallu 2024-02-16 00:20:52 +01:00
  • bb06b422f5 remove roge double quote Félix Piédallu 2024-02-15 23:54:36 +01:00
  • 1b0d630f6c Handle cases with already existing branch / commit Félix Piédallu 2024-02-15 23:46:12 +01:00
  • 7e0c5fdac1 Fix duplicate code Félix Piédallu 2024-02-15 23:13:16 +01:00
  • 4e9c99cc4d Update app levels according to CI results root 2024-02-16 17:00:12 +00:00
  • 0d2d5e5c33 Merge pull request #2020 from oufmilo/master Tagada 2024-02-16 00:13:46 +01:00
  • 1327beaaea Merge pull request #2027 from Salamandar/fix_autoupdater Alexandre Aubin 2024-02-15 23:31:21 +01:00
  • 69684f4066 Use a state enum to handle already existing update prs Félix Piédallu 2024-02-15 23:13:16 +01:00
  • 3c204ecd57 autoupdate_app_sources: set proper defaults on argparse, just to be sure Félix Piédallu 2024-02-15 22:52:11 +01:00
  • 9077b9793e Add proper arguments to autoupdate_app_sources.py Félix Piédallu 2024-02-15 22:51:45 +01:00
  • 501ee835b7 Merge pull request #2026 from Salamandar/compat_union_optional Alexandre Aubin 2024-02-15 22:47:41 +01:00
  • 64aa8fe4f4 Fix compatibility with python3.9: use union, optional from typing Félix Piédallu 2024-02-15 22:42:06 +01:00
  • 7707e08d4b Fix compatibility with python3.9: use union, optional from typing Félix Piédallu 2024-02-15 22:42:06 +01:00
  • fad58b623e Merge pull request #2025 from YunoHost/rallly Alexandre Aubin 2024-02-15 19:09:18 +01:00
  • 20b57e0a5b Update apps.toml Éric Gaspar 2024-02-15 18:55:11 +01:00
  • 36884268eb deprecated alltube (#2024) OniriCorpe 2024-02-15 18:36:51 +01:00
  • e9acbf8d12 Merge pull request #2023 from Salamandar/rework_autoupdater Alexandre Aubin 2024-02-15 17:22:07 +01:00
  • 2a5ec79151 Add cron stuff Alexandre Aubin 2024-02-15 17:15:08 +01:00
  • 5936ec4b01 Add back the logging_sender Félix Piédallu 2024-02-15 15:14:19 +01:00
  • c1ef372c2c Cleanup for mypy, code simplification Félix Piédallu 2024-02-15 11:05:48 +01:00
  • b8eba67a99 Handle invalid syntax in some local app's manifest during initial apps listing Félix Piédallu 2024-02-15 11:04:57 +01:00
  • 48870e56d6 Remove debug print Félix Piédallu 2024-02-15 09:54:03 +01:00
  • c98cd372be Merge pull request #2022 from Salamandar/rename_readme_generator Alexandre Aubin 2024-02-15 17:03:57 +01:00
  • 2eeee2541b Rename README-generator -> readme_generator because python tools hate caps… Félix Piédallu 2024-02-15 14:57:57 +01:00
  • 49a981c3f6 Reorganize the gitignore Félix Piédallu 2024-02-15 14:56:55 +01:00
  • 690981ab9e Merge pull request #2021 from OniriCorpe/update-manifestv2-schema Alexandre Aubin 2024-02-15 01:55:06 +01:00
  • 25fe3b356b add gitea and forgejo autoupdate strategies OniriCorpe 2024-02-15 01:50:31 +01:00
  • f90a9f54cb Add logos oufmilo 2024-02-15 01:29:23 +01:00
  • 2205f0a0b0 Merge pull request #2017 from OniriCorpe/librarian-deprecated Alexandre Aubin 2024-02-15 01:25:33 +01:00
  • 503105ffb7 revert formatter OniriCorpe 2024-02-15 01:23:10 +01:00
  • 0b4ba4e379 Merge pull request #2019 from Salamandar/rework_autoupdater Alexandre Aubin 2024-02-15 01:12:44 +01:00
  • 589a176695 Merge pull request #2015 from Salamandar/rework_autoupdater_part_1 Alexandre Aubin 2024-02-15 01:11:33 +01:00
  • a0d531b11f Merge pull request #2018 from Salamandar/fix_rest_api Alexandre Aubin 2024-02-15 01:11:13 +01:00
  • 918bc1a1b9 Remove testing Félix Piédallu 2024-02-15 00:04:50 +01:00
  • 1c260fa6b6 Fix typing for giteaforgejoapi, fix url_for_ref for gitlab Félix Piédallu 2024-02-14 23:56:32 +01:00
  • 0739ccb850 Fix typing for giteaforgejoapi, fix url_for_ref for gitlab Félix Piédallu 2024-02-14 23:56:32 +01:00
  • 2295b10242 Merge pull request #2016 from Salamandar/list_builder_argparse Alexandre Aubin 2024-02-14 22:59:20 +01:00
  • 25e93c6c73 librarian is deprecated OniriCorpe 2024-02-14 22:51:25 +01:00
  • b614b3ba98 tools/list_builder.py: use argparse to set target dir, jobs count, and disable cache updating Félix Piédallu 2024-02-14 22:44:19 +01:00
  • 72211961b5 finish autoupdater rework Félix Piédallu 2024-02-14 22:01:07 +01:00
  • 42b97a2df8 Revamp autoupdate_app_sources.py Félix Piédallu 2024-02-12 16:59:54 +01:00
  • 9200caee2c Small cleanup of autoupdate try..except..else Félix Piédallu 2024-02-11 20:08:37 +01:00
  • eea62e4236 Remove duplicate data Félix Piédallu 2024-02-11 20:06:26 +01:00
  • 610e49b1f3 Use tqdm instead of home-made progressbar Félix Piédallu 2024-02-11 20:04:34 +01:00
  • 60831358a7 Add sys.path.insert to import appslib Félix Piédallu 2024-02-10 15:13:45 +01:00
  • e32c11e200 Use pathlib.Path Félix Piédallu 2024-02-10 15:02:05 +01:00
  • 1f5b104764 Use argparse, move github auth logic temporarily in main() Félix Piédallu 2024-02-10 13:54:36 +01:00
  • e811fffe72 Use main() function Félix Piédallu 2024-02-10 13:46:11 +01:00
  • b844704b2b Merge pull request #2014 from OniriCorpe/fix-autoupdate Tagada 2024-02-14 22:09:04 +01:00
  • 61f053f3b8 fix latest_release_html_url assignement OniriCorpe 2024-02-14 22:06:13 +01:00
  • 6d21a8658c Merge pull request #2013 from YunoHost/add-to-wishlist-microweber Tagada 2024-02-14 19:12:58 +01:00
  • 5ab52930f4 Merge pull request #2009 from YunoHost/add-to-wishlist-script-server Tagada 2024-02-14 19:10:03 +01:00
  • b399b394b1 Add Microweber to wishlist yunohost-bot 2024-02-14 19:04:47 +01:00
  • 09d34e5c1f Merge pull request #2012 from OniriCorpe/gitea-forgejo-api-autoupdate Alexandre Aubin 2024-02-14 15:39:16 +01:00
  • c51e87fd66 we don't need that, it's handled by GitlabAPI OniriCorpe 2024-02-14 05:42:04 +01:00
  • a019ac2c63 lol forgot debug prints OniriCorpe 2024-02-14 05:28:37 +01:00
  • 153f3de6d9 small enhancement OniriCorpe 2024-02-14 05:27:25 +01:00
  • f3743b15a3 small refactor OniriCorpe 2024-02-14 05:00:07 +01:00
  • 78ea65f7fc wasn't a typo lmao i'm too tired OniriCorpe 2024-02-14 04:24:02 +01:00
  • f628744126 typo OniriCorpe 2024-02-14 04:23:03 +01:00
  • 9647844060 supports 1.13.1-2 version numbers OniriCorpe 2024-02-14 04:21:10 +01:00
  • be03798ede removing irrelevant project_id OniriCorpe 2024-02-14 04:08:31 +01:00
  • a213afcb8c small fixes OniriCorpe 2024-02-14 03:58:37 +01:00
  • 019c446f57 fix strategies (split gitea & forgejo) OniriCorpe 2024-02-14 03:43:16 +01:00
  • 95c1d1b14e Initial support for Gitea & Forgejo OniriCorpe 2024-02-14 03:40:26 +01:00
  • e84ba88c61 add octoprint Gredin67 2024-02-13 12:44:23 +01:00
  • f17be33ce0 Add script-server to wishlist yunohost-bot 2024-02-11 17:04:56 +01:00
  • 0b892bf0bd Merge pull request #2008 from fflorent/add-mautrix-discord eric_G 2024-02-11 14:44:02 +01:00
  • 770491ae70 Add mautrix_discord to catalog Florent 2024-02-11 12:04:36 +01:00